Park or stop in a loading zone unless you: are a bus dropping off, or picking up, passengersstopping no longer than 30 minutes, are a truck dropping off, or picking up, passengers or goodsstopping no longer than 30 minutes, have a commercial vehicle identification label issued by the local government for that area (stopping no longer than 30 minutes), are dropping off or picking up passengers (stopping no more than 2 minutes), are dropping off or picking up passengers with a disability (stopping no more than 5 minutes), are dropping off or picking up goods (stopping no more than 20 minutes). Obtain a certificate from the Commissioner of Police, stating the vehicle is not recorded as stolen at least 28 days before the vehicle is to be moved or sold. Parking signs show you where and when you can park or stop. It's important to read the entire parking sign and understand how it applies to the day and time on which you're parking. Follow these steps to buy an unregistered vehicle: Step 1: Check the vehicle registration Before you buy a vehicle, you can check the vehicle registration to confirm the vehicle is not listed as stolen, written off or has money owing on it.
